ABT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2013 in Review

1,384 of the 3,446 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Abbott (ABT) for Q4 2013, worth a combined $40.9B — up 17% from $34.9B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 161 funds opened new ABT positions and 71 closed out — a net gain of 90 holders — while 513 added to existing stakes and 534 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Neuberger Berman Group, adding an estimated $198M. The largest seller was BlackRock Institutional Trust, cutting an estimated $128M.
